About Us
General Lee Aviation (GLA) and Wetaskiwin Air Services (WAS) are an integrated aviation company in Central Alberta that offer an approved aircraft maintenance organization (AMO), flight training unit (FTU), simulator instruction and third‑party aircraft maintenance services. WAS was established in 1975 and we are proud to have been operating for over 50 years with a strong emphasis on safety, quality workmanship, accountability and a healthy, respectful work environment.
The Role
We are seeking a Director of Maintenance (DOM) to lead our maintenance organization as the Person Responsible for Maintenance (PRM). The DOM will be accountable for how maintenance is executed, documented, planned and delivered across the company and third‑party aircraft. The Director of Maintenance is expected to remain technically engaged, lead from the shop floor, participate in inspections and troubleshooting when required, and maintain credibility with AMEs through direct involvement. Candidates seeking a primarily administrative or compliance‑only position should not apply.
